Maserati: Maserati is, just like Ferrari, one of the top car manufacturers in the world when it comes to the luxury sports car segment. The company was founded in 1914 and over the years it has been owned by Orsi, Citroen, and Fiat. Recently it has become a part of the sports car group that includes Alfa Romeo. Another example of an Italian sports and racing car manufacturer which eventually went defunct, Cisitalia was a well-known company for almost 20 years. The company name comes from “Compagnia Industriale Sportiva Italia,” a group founded in 1946, and controlled by Piero Dusio.

Siata initially sold performance parts to modify and tune cars manufactured by Fiat.After World War II, the company began …Automobili Lamborghini S.p.A. or popularly known as Lamborghini is another Italian auto manufacturer of luxury SUVs and sports cars. It was founded in 1963 by Ferruccio Lamborghini to compete against the top sports car manufacturer of that time, "Ferrari." The company saw a massive rise in its first decade.

A group of investors, including Giovanni Agnelli, founded this company in 1899 and within 25 years Fiat dominated the car industry in Italy. Fiat sells cars across the globe and has won the European Car of the Year award on twelve occasions. This manufacturer makes a wide range of vehicles, including sports cars, small road cars, trucks, and vans.

Official Website: Fiat. Fiat is the oldest Italian car manufacturer known for its small cars and is one of the largest car manufacturers in the world. Fiat was founded in Turin in 1899 by Giovanni Agnelli and was then known for making luxury cars.De Tomaso Automobili Ltd. (previously known as De Tomaso Modena SpA) is an Italian car-manufacturing company.It was founded 1959 by Alejandro de Tomaso in Modena.It originally produced various sports prototypes and auto racing vehicles, including a Formula One car for Frank Williams Racing Cars in 1970.
